References by co-proprietors under section 20(1)(b)
Subregulation 1
A reference under section 20(1)(b) shall be made on Patents Form 2 and shall be accompanied by a statement setting out fully the nature of the question, the facts relied upon by the co-proprietor making the reference and the order he is seeking.
Subregulation 2
The Registrar shall send a copy of the reference and statement to —
each co-proprietor who is not a party to the reference and who has not otherwise indicated, in writing, his consent to the making of the order sought;
any person to whom it is alleged in the reference that any right in or under an application for a patent should be transferred or granted;
any person (not being a party to the reference) who is shown in the register as having a right in or under the patent application;
any person (not being a party to the reference) who has given notice to the Registrar of a relevant transaction, instrument or event; and
every person who has been identified in the application for the patent or a statement filed under section 24(2)(a) as being, or being believed to be, the inventor or joint inventor of the invention.
Subregulation 3
Any person who receives a copy of the reference and statement and who wishes to oppose the order sought may, within 2 months from the date of the Registrar’s letter forwarding copies of the reference and statement, file a counter-statement on Form HC6 setting out fully the grounds of his opposition.
Subregulation 4
The Registrar shall, as appropriate, send a copy of any counter-statement to —
each co-proprietor who is a party to the reference; and
any person to whom a copy of the reference and statement were sent pursuant to paragraph (2).
Subregulation 5
Any person who receives a copy of the counter-statement may, within 2 months from the date of the Registrar’s letter forwarding such copy, file evidence in support of his case and shall send a copy of the evidence so filed to the co-proprietor making the reference and to each person who has filed a counter-statement.
Subregulation 6
Any person entitled to receive a copy of the evidence filed under paragraph (5) may, within 2 months from the date of receipt of the copy of such evidence or, if no such evidence is filed, within 2 months from the expiration of the period within which it could have been filed, file evidence in support of his case and shall send a copy of the evidence so filed to each of the other parties listed in paragraph (4).
Subregulation 7
Any person who receives a copy of the evidence filed under paragraph (6) may, within 2 months from the date of receipt of the copy of such evidence, file further evidence confined to matters strictly in reply and shall, as appropriate, send a copy of the evidence so filed to the parties listed in paragraph (4).
Subregulation 8
No further evidence shall be filed by any party except with permission or by direction of the Registrar.
Subregulation 9
The Registrar may give such directions as he may think fit with regard to any aspect of the procedure for the reference.
